MN Weather: Below-Normal Temperatures To Start November

Colder weather will greet Minnesotans to start the month of November.

Lows will dip into the 20s starting next week. High temperatures will stay in the 40s.

MINNEAPOLIS — Residents in the Twin Cities metro should expect below-normal temperatures at the end of October and begin November.

Lows will dip into the 20s starting next week. High temperatures will stay in the 40s.

Here's the full National Weather Service forecast for the Twin Cities metro area:

Wednesday: A 40 percent chance of rain. Mostly cloudy, with a high near 53. East southeast wind around 10 mph.
Wednesday Night: Rain, mainly after 7pm. Low around 45. Southeast wind 5 to 10 mph. Chance of precipitation is 100%. New precipitation amounts between a quarter and half of an inch possible.
Thursday: Rain, mainly before 1pm. High near 51. Light and variable wind becoming north 5 to 10 mph in the afternoon. Chance of precipitation is 90%. New precipitation amounts between a quarter and half of an inch possible.
Thursday Night: A 10 percent chance of rain before 7pm.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 43. North wind 5 to 10 mph.
Friday: Partly sunny, with a high near 54. North wind around 10 mph.
Friday Night: Mostly clear, with a low around 38. North wind around 5 mph becoming calm in the evening.
Saturday: Sunny, with a high near 57. Calm wind becoming west around 5 mph.
Saturday Night: Mostly clear, with a low around 38. Northwest wind 5 to 10 mph.
Sunday: Mostly sunny, with a high near 46. Northwest wind 10 to 15 mph.
Sunday Night: Mostly clear, with a low around 30. West northwest wind 5 to 10 mph.
Monday: Mostly sunny, with a high near 43. West wind 5 to 10 mph.
Monday Night: Partly cloudy, with a low around 28. West wind around 5 mph.
Tuesday: Mostly sunny, with a high near 42. West wind 5 to 10 mph.
Tuesday Night: Partly cloudy, with a low around 28. West northwest wind around 5 mph.
Wednesday: Mostly sunny, with a high near 40. Northwest wind 5 to 10 mph.
